Click on the anchored figure and try to ungoup it by 1) right click, 2) scroll down to group menu item, You have no selection at the right of the ungroup Then do 1) right click, 2) scroll down to anchor and chnage anchoring from "As character", to any other anchoring option (e.g. to "to character" and then you will be able to ungroup it.

I can't see for what "ungroup" of such an image 'anchored as character' could be useful. All elements would be anchored as characters as a long chain of characters, or what result do you expect? But of course, it would be useful if "edit group" would be offered. But this would be an ENHANCEMENT.
I do not agree or not understand what you mean : the anchor type apply to the figure as a whole not to single elements of the figure???? Plus what is then the difference to "to character" which works?
